Your concern and particular situation is similar to what mine was when I started my course, so I figured I should share my experience, in case it helps your decision.

 

I've had moderate acne (mostly hormonal and) for the past 17 years (!) and finally had enough when my back decided to break out horribly last December (never had much of a problem with back acne before then). Although I never thought my skin was bad enough to warrant taking Accutane, I was so fed up that I decided to use my last resort. I weigh 63 kg and my derm started me on 80mg/day. I was pretty freaked out, but she told me she likes to bring out the big dogs in the beginning, because she feels it works better that way and decreases the course length (i.e., 4 months as opposed to 6 or so). She said if the side effects were too much we could always decrease the dose. So I trusted her expertise and started on 80 mg/day.

 

I'm on day 36 and have not had any major problems, so far. My side effects seem pretty typical compared to what I've seen on the forums (i.e., dry everything and somewhat sore back - I might be imagining the sore back, though) and completely manageable. Really the only thing that I notice on a regular basis is the dry lips. Annoying, for sure, but tolerable with lots of Aquaphor. I was worried what my 1 month bloodwork would look like with such a high dose, but everything was normal, so I'm continuing with my 80mg/day dosage. I am also quite lucky that I have not had the dreaded initial breakout...at least not yet (fingers crossed). My skin began improving after the first week and has continued to do so. Since the end of my first week, I've gotten maybe two or three measly pimples per week (!) and they don't stick around very long. Before Accutane, I used to get two or three nastier ones about every other day that would get inflamed and take forever to go away. My derm says that's a good sign - hope she's right!

 

So, you might want to go with your derm's advice and see how your system handles it. You can always drop the dosage if the side effects are too bothersome. Let me warn you, though, that I thought the side effects were the worst from about Day 5 to Day 12, mainly due to a very very itchy scalp and general itchiness all over, but I guess my body adjusted. Since then, as long as I use lotion after I shower, and after I wash my face, I don't even notice the dryness (except the lips, of course).

hmm, ive had long chats to my derm and he says its unprofessional to start people on such a high dose. apparently a lot of derms did this in 10-15 years ago and it caused a massive initial breakout that left people with a lot of scarring. derms now tend to start off low and build up to avoid that. suppose if you arent having any problems, its all good :) im 63kgs and am on 20mgs for the first three months before increasing the dose.

from what i've been reading, the higher doses have lead to a smaller or non existant initial breakout. probably because it shuts down the sebaceous glands a lot quicker. im going to be starting on 40/80mg on odd/even days as soon as my blood work is done.
